Yes I do totally agree that 'Make Me' should at least made the top 20 in the UK, it did on the sales chart, but streaming well and truly ruined it, and can't believe that Katy Perry's 'Rise' outperformed this, this was clearly the much better song. It deserved a much higher placing than #42 for god's sake, well it just shows how terrible the charts are these days and considering this was her comeback single, it's just a travesty. It should at least managed a top 20 placing, like it did in the USA.

There are a couple of her singles that are underrated, like 'Til The World Ends', a massive #3 hit in the USA, but could only manage #21 here in the UK, Also 'I Wanna Go' which again a massive top 10 hit in USA, but totally tanked at #111 and even 'Slumber Party' which I know is new, but hasn't even made a dent over here at all and didn't do very well elsewhere.
